Bengaluru gets 2.65 million dollars EV boost with JOULE

Bengaluru, Sep 16 (UNI) The Climate Pledge, co-founded by Amazon and Global Optimism, launched a major investment initiative on Monday to accelerate electric vehicle (EV) adoption in Bengaluru.
The project, JOULE (Joint Operation Unifying Last-mile Electrification), aims to raise US$2.65 million by 2030 to develop a network of shared EV charging stations. These stations will support approximately 5,500 electric vehicles and contribute to the city’s shift towards clean energy.
Key supporters of JOULE include Amazon, Mahindra Logistics, Uber, HCLTech, Greenko, and Deloitte, with Indian EV platform Kazam set to construct the stations. Renewable energy provider Greenko will power the project, which is expected to deliver 22,700 megawatt-hours of energy by 2030. This will save 11.2 million litres of fuel and cut carbon emissions by 25,700 tonnes.
“Together with the Pledge signatories, we are proud to launch this joint action initiative, which will support India’s transition to electric vehicles,” said Sally Fouts, Global Leader of The Climate Pledge. “This project not only addresses some of the current challenges in India’s charging infrastructure but also sets a new standard for corporate climate collaboration.”
JOULE’s first charging station is now operational in Doddakallasandra, with five more planned by the end of the year. The initiative aims to resolve India’s current infrastructure deficit, where there is just one charging station per 135 EVs, far from the desired ratio of one station per 20 vehicles. The new stations will serve corporate fleets and be accessible to other companies, ensuring optimal usage.
“This initiative not only improves the accessibility of EV infrastructure but also shows the strength of public-private partnerships in driving India’s transition to a more sustainable future,” said Gunjan Krishna, Karnataka’s Industries Commissioner.
The project is projected to create 185 full-time jobs between 2024 and 2030. It also builds on The Climate Pledge’s previous initiatives, such as the Laneshift programme, which supports the deployment of zero-emission vehicles in major Indian cities.
“JOULE represents a crucial milestone in our shared mission to combat climate change and drive the transition to green mobility,” said Paras Shah, COO and Co-Founder of Kazam.
As India pushes towards its goal of 30% of new vehicle sales being electric by 2030, JOULE will play a pivotal role in establishing the infrastructure necessary to achieve this target.
